12 Aug 2019 Embassy of France in Australia

The Pacific Fund is meant to initiate projects and not to support the development of a project through time. In case you foresee that the project you are submitting might lead to a potential re-application later on, this has to be mentioned from the start.

The projects must be co-financed at least at 50 % of the total amount of the eligible expenses

16 Aug 2019 Lord Mayor’s Charitable Foundation

Our work is organised around Impact Areas, which are revised following research and wide consultation with stakeholders as part of our strategic planning process.
 
The Impact Areas are currently alleviating homelessness; increasing community resilience to withstand major social and health challenges; reducing urban impacts on the natural environment; and reducing education and economic inequality.

19 Aug 2019 Cherry Gertzel Postgraduate Scholarship

The Cherry Gertzel Bursary Award is an annual award to assist female post-graduate students to complete study or research in African Studies.

One bursary of $10,000 will be awarded annually.

19 Aug 2019 Euan Crone Asian Awareness Scholarship

The Australian Institute of International Affairs invites applications for the Euan Crone Asian awareness scholarship. This promotes a better understanding of Asia among young Australians by enabling travel and study in Asian countries. Applications will be accepted for projects in India, Pakistan, Bangladesh, Sri Lanka, China, Japan, Korea, Taiwan, the Philippines, Myanmar, Thailand, Malaysia, Indonesia, Singapore, Vietnam, Laos and Cambodia.
